Chelsea are pushing Swansea City to sell Fernando Llorente.
The Daily Star says the Spanish international, 32, was the subject of two offers from the Blues in January.
But Swansea refused to sell at that time because they were involved in a relegation battle.
Llorente, who played under Antonio Conte at Juventus, remains a target although Chelsea are not prepared to meet his current £30m price tag.
They want to pay around £15m for the ex-Sevilla and Athletic Bilbao forward who finished as the Swans' top scorer last season with 15 goals in 33 league games.
